Winter Layering Outfits for Women: Stay Warm, Stylish, and Comfortable

Winter dressing does not have to mean sacrificing style for warmth. With the right combination of clothing, you can create winter layering outfits for women that are comfortable, practical, and fashionable. Layering allows you to adjust your outfit throughout the day while combining different textures, colors, and silhouettes.

From cozy sweaters and tailored coats to thermal basics and stylish scarves, the key to successful winter layering is knowing how each piece works together. Whether you are dressing for work, a casual weekend, travel, or a special occasion, thoughtful layers can transform your cold-weather wardrobe.

What Is Winter Layering?

Winter layering means wearing multiple clothing pieces together to create warmth and flexibility. Instead of relying on one thick garment, you can combine lightweight layers that trap warm air while allowing you to remove or add pieces as temperatures change.

A typical layered outfit may include a base layer, a middle layer, and an outer layer. Accessories such as scarves, hats, gloves, and socks can provide additional warmth.

The best layering outfits balance three things: warmth, comfort, and proportion.

Essential Layers for Women’s Winter Outfits

Building winter outfits becomes much easier when you understand the purpose of each layer.

Layer Recommended Pieces Main Purpose
Base layer Thermal top, fitted tee, camisole Retains warmth and manages moisture
Mid layer Sweater, cardigan, fleece, sweatshirt Adds insulation
Outer layer Coat, puffer, parka, trench Protects against cold and weather
Bottom layer Jeans, trousers, leggings, skirts Provides warmth and structure
Accessories Scarf, gloves, hat Adds extra protection
Footwear Boots, insulated shoes Keeps feet warm and dry

Not every outfit requires every layer. On milder winter days, a lightweight base layer and sweater under a coat may be enough. In extremely cold weather, you can add thermal leggings, thicker knitwear, and weather-resistant outerwear.

Casual Winter Layering Outfits

For everyday winter dressing, comfort should be the priority without making the outfit look bulky.

Try pairing a fitted long-sleeve top with straight-leg jeans, a chunky knit sweater, and a long wool coat. Add ankle or knee-high boots and a scarf for extra warmth.

Another easy combination is a basic T-shirt layered under a cardigan, paired with relaxed trousers and a quilted jacket. This outfit works particularly well for errands, coffee dates, shopping, and casual gatherings.

If you prefer a sporty aesthetic, combine a thermal top with a hoodie, leggings, and a puffer jacket. Complete the look with sneakers or insulated boots.

Winter Layering Outfits for Work

Layering is especially useful for professional wardrobes because indoor offices can be much warmer than outdoor temperatures.

A fitted blouse underneath a lightweight sweater creates a polished base. Add tailored trousers and a structured wool coat for commuting. If your workplace is casual, substitute the blouse with a fine-knit turtleneck.

A monochromatic outfit can make layered clothing appear more streamlined. For example, combine black trousers, a charcoal sweater, a black coat, and matching boots. The different textures prevent the outfit from looking flat while maintaining a sophisticated appearance.

Avoid combining too many oversized pieces in professional outfits. If your sweater is loose, consider pairing it with tailored trousers or a structured coat.

Layering Dresses in Winter

You do not have to stop wearing dresses when temperatures fall. Dresses can become excellent winter layering pieces.

Wear a fitted turtleneck underneath a sleeveless dress for a modern layered look. Alternatively, layer a cardigan or cropped sweater over a midi dress.

For additional warmth, wear opaque tights and knee-high boots. A long coat can complete the outfit while creating a continuous silhouette.

Sweater dresses are another winter staple. They can be worn alone with boots or layered over thermal tops and tights when temperatures are particularly low.

Winter Layering With Jeans

Jeans are one of the easiest foundations for winter outfits. Straight-leg, wide-leg, skinny, and bootcut styles can all work with different layers.

For a classic outfit, pair high-rise jeans with a fitted turtleneck, oversized cardigan, and wool coat. Add leather boots and a structured handbag for a polished finish.

Wide-leg jeans can be balanced with a shorter jacket or a partially tucked sweater. If you choose an oversized coat as well, keep the base layer relatively streamlined to maintain visual balance.

Winter Layering With Skirts

Skirts can also work beautifully in cold weather when combined with appropriate layers.

Try a midi skirt with a fitted sweater, long coat, tights, and knee-high boots. For a more casual outfit, pair a denim skirt with a chunky sweater, thick tights, and ankle boots.

When wearing multiple layers with a skirt, consider where each garment ends. Coordinating lengths can help the outfit look intentional rather than cluttered.

Layering for Extremely Cold Weather

When temperatures drop significantly, focus on function before fashion.

Start with a moisture-managing base layer. Add a fleece, wool sweater, or insulated mid-layer. Finish with a warm coat designed for the conditions.

Thermal leggings can be worn beneath jeans or trousers, while wool socks can provide additional insulation. A scarf can protect the neck, and insulated gloves and a warm hat help reduce heat loss from exposed areas.

The important principle is to use several relatively manageable layers rather than one extremely restrictive layer. This gives you greater control over your temperature.

How to Avoid Looking Bulky

One of the biggest challenges with winter layering is excess volume. Wearing several thick garments simultaneously can make movement uncomfortable and obscure your silhouette.

A simple solution is to vary the thickness of your layers.

For example, choose a fitted thermal top as your base, a medium-weight sweater as the middle layer, and a roomy coat as the outer layer. This creates warmth without requiring every garment to be oversized.

You can also use strategic proportions. A cropped jacket can work well over a longer sweater, while a long coat can balance slim trousers or leggings.

Best Winter Colors for Layering

Winter wardrobes often rely on neutral colors because they are easy to combine. Black, gray, cream, camel, navy, brown, and burgundy can create sophisticated combinations.

You can also use one bright color as an accent. A red scarf, emerald sweater, or colorful handbag can add personality to an otherwise neutral outfit.

For an especially polished appearance, choose layers within the same color family but vary their textures. Combining wool, denim, leather, knitwear, and quilted fabrics can create visual interest.

Winter Layering Accessories

Accessories are not just decorative during winter. They can provide meaningful warmth.

A large scarf can protect your neck and add color or texture to an outfit. Beanies and wool hats provide additional coverage, while gloves protect your hands during outdoor activities.

Boots are particularly versatile for winter styling. Knee-high boots can complement dresses and skirts, while ankle boots pair naturally with jeans and trousers.

When choosing accessories, consider the overall proportions of your outfit. A large scarf can complement a simple coat, while a more structured outfit may benefit from streamlined accessories.

Simple Winter Layering Formula

If you are unsure how to start, use this basic formula:

Base layer + comfortable mid-layer + protective outer layer + winter accessories.

For example:

Turtleneck + knit sweater + wool coat + jeans + boots + scarf

This formula can be adapted to different temperatures, personal styles, and occasions.
